ALL of these are possible with right amount of $$$...  Wrestlemania is supposed to be the BIG event with Dream Matches and Returning Superstars...
 
Those are wishful thinking matches, that are not possible. Brock Lesnar is in a lawsuit with the WWE, Sting has signed a 1 yr. contract with TNA.  Bret since his stroke can't wrestle anymore, very bad feelings between Randy Savage and WWE, and a lawsuit is in the works between Ultimate Warrior and McMahon.  No love between those two either.....

Dear Georgie,
Read your article about wrestling at MSG.  Last night I was watching WWE 24/7--Wrestling from MSG November 23, 1981--and there you were right there in the second row.  Aisle seat.
Watching Pedro Morales beat Don Muraco for the Intercontinental Championship.  I am certain that it was you, because you sent me a couple photos in the past.
Ringside sure was crowded back then.  There didn't appear to be much floor space around the ring.  There were dozens of people milling about--taking photos--sitting in folding chairs etc.  Not sure what there purpose was in being there other than to just be in the way.  But then again, there was not much action outside the ring.
Watching Old School is probably the best part of having 24/7.  Lately I have been very disappointed with the WWE.  Not very entertaining.  Some of the matches at the Royal Rumble were down right pathetic.  This is a shame.  I hope they get their act together soon, because I am honestly getting tired of waiting.
Talk to you later,    Kathy Keeley
 
Yes Kathy, that was me sitting in second row, aisle seat.  We had 10 reserved seats in second and third rows and loved them.  So many great memories.
The guys around ringside back then were probably - George Napolitano, Bill Apter and Frank Amato - just a few photographers allowed at ringside.  Now only George has access......
I agree about 24/7, the best part is watching the history of old school wrestling.  When wrestling was so much fun to watch.
